Santa Rosa

A delightful mélange of the big town and small town feel define the warm and friendly town of Santa Rosa. The climate here makes it a perfect location for vacationing while the town’s wineries and adventures make it the ultimate location to rejuvenate the mind and body. In fact, the Santa Rosa wineries are acclaimed in the state of California and so visitors make it a sure point to stop by and taste some of the best and fresh wines being served. Outdoor activities would surely disappoint anyone for there is abundance of it here in Santa Rosa. For instance, the Annadel State Park nearby and the lovely Spring Lake are great options for entertainment. Arts and culture find their second home in Santa Rosa; right from museums to fine theatre productions, there is almost every kind for all of us. The Tomato Festival and Chinese New Year Celebrations are a must watch!
